I was walking through the woodpile, looking for something to turn when I spied a medium sized cottonwood log. The ends had some pretty bad checking and I could see there was some rot on one end but I went ahead and got out the chainsaw and trimmed off the ends.

Roughed it to a cylinder and saw that there was alot going on color and grain wise. Forced myself to rough it into a different shape than usual (not much different, but a little different). There was a lot of punky areas, the wood was soft and of course there was a rotten spot. Even with sharp tools there was alot of tearout and sanding was an ordeal because the wood was so soft. With alot of sanding with the grain with the lathe stopped, I was able to get a nice surface.
Doused with BLO (the punky areas soaked it up like there was no tomorrow) and will probably add some base coats of shellac before adding WOP. It's about 8" x 4" and walls about 1/8".
I think I did ok with the curves, but I think may have somewhat of a flat spot just below the midsection and I think I should have curved the top more.
